[0001] This disclosure relates to image positioning technology, and more specifically, to a method and apparatus for constructing a three-dimensional model. Background Art

[0002] Image localization is a fundamental task in robotics and augmented reality, and is the cornerstone of realistic scene reconstruction. Accurate localization is a necessary condition to ensure the realism and reliability of the reconstructed 3D results.

[0003] Currently, 3D reconstruction algorithms generally use two-dimensional feature points to calculate the relative pose between images. This type of algorithm is easily affected by environmental changes such as lighting. Furthermore, monocular images lack scale information in localization and reconstruction, and as the number of images involved in the calculation increases, localization drift becomes a significant problem.

[0004] In addition, combining high-precision lidar ranging and two-dimensional images can achieve better mapping results, but this method requires the simultaneous acquisition of lidar data and image data, which limits its effectiveness.

[0005] Therefore, there is a need to provide a method for accurately constructing 3D models. Summary of the Invention

[0064] <Method Example>

[0065] One embodiment of the present invention provides a method for constructing a three-dimensional model. According to... Figure 1 As shown, the method for constructing the three-dimensional model in this embodiment may include the following steps S110 to S150.

[0066] S110, acquire a first image, at least one second image, and a three-dimensional point cloud map; wherein the first image and at least one second image have a first common feature point.

[0067] A 3D point cloud map is a map generated based on 3D point cloud data obtained from panoramic scanning using a LiDAR sensor.

[0068] The first and second images are obtained by taking pictures of different scenes in a panorama or the same scene from different angles using a camera.

[0069] Common feature points are imaging points in different images that correspond to the same scene.

[0070] In the case where there is only one second image, the first image and the second image share a first set of common feature points.

[0071] When there are multiple second images, the first image and each second image share a set of first common feature points. Each set of first common feature points can contain multiple points. The first common feature points of any two sets can be different.

[0072] S120, determine the depth information of the first common feature point based on the first common feature point in the first image and the three-dimensional point cloud map.

[0073] In one specific embodiment, S120 includes S121 to S123.

[0074] S121, Obtain the camera pose information of the first image.

[0075] The camera pose information for the first image is known and can be obtained directly.

[0076] S122, Based on the camera pose information of the first image, project the 3D point cloud map onto the camera imaging plane corresponding to the first image to obtain the projection result.

[0077] Figure 2 This is a schematic diagram of a three-dimensional point cloud map projected onto the camera imaging plane corresponding to a first image according to an embodiment of the present invention.

[0078] Based on the camera pose information of the first image, the position and orientation of the camera corresponding to the first image in the 3D point cloud map can be determined.

[0079] After determining the position and orientation of the camera corresponding to the first image in the 3D point cloud map, refer to... Figure 2A quadrangular pyramid is formed with the camera's center O1 as its vertex and the camera's imaging plane S corresponding to the first image as its base. The depth of the quadrangular pyramid is a pre-calibrated parameter.

[0080] By projecting the radar points enclosed in the quadrangular pyramid onto the camera imaging plane corresponding to the first image along a direction perpendicular to the camera imaging plane of the first image, the projection results of each radar point are obtained.

[0081] S123, when the projection point of a radar point in the projection result is a three-dimensional point cloud map coincides with a first common feature point, determine the distance between the radar point and the first common feature point as the depth information of the first common feature point.

[0082] When the projected points of multiple radar points in the three-dimensional point cloud map coincide with the same first common feature point, the distance between each radar point and the same first common feature point is determined, and the minimum distance is taken as the depth information of the same common feature point.

[0083] It should be noted that not every common feature point can be used to determine a corresponding depth information.

[0084] S130, construct a first three-dimensional model based on the depth information of the first common feature point, the position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the first image, and the camera pose information of the first image.

[0085] When there are multiple second images, a 3D model in the camera coordinate system of the first image can be constructed based on the depth information of a set of first common feature points in the first image, the position information of the set of first common feature points in the first image in the camera coordinate system, and the camera pose information of the first image. Then, the 3D model in the camera coordinate system of the first image is transformed into a 3D model in the world coordinate system to serve as the first 3D model.

[0086] Specifically, based on the depth information of each common feature point, the position information of each common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the first image, and the camera pose information of the first image, the three-dimensional position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the first image can be obtained. Then, the three-dimensional position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the first image is converted into the three-dimensional position information in the world coordinate system.

[0087] The first 3D model information includes the coordinate information of multiple 3D points and the camera pose information of each image.

[0088] The number of first common feature points participating in the construction of the first 3D model exceeds a preset threshold. Preferably, the group with the largest number of first common feature points is used in the construction of the first 3D model.

[0089] When there are multiple second images, a 3D model in the camera coordinate system of the first image can be constructed based on the depth information of each group of first common feature points in the first image, the position information of each group of first common feature points in the first image in the camera coordinate system, and the camera pose information of the first image. Then, the 3D model in the camera coordinate system of the first image is transformed into a 3D model in the world coordinate system to serve as the first 3D model.

[0090] S140, based on the depth information of the first common feature point and the position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, determine the camera pose information of the corresponding second image.

[0091] In the case of a single second image, the camera pose information of the second image is determined based on the Perspective-n-Point (PnP) algorithm, according to the depth information of the first common feature point and the position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image.

[0092] When there are multiple second images, the PnP algorithm is used to determine the camera pose information of the corresponding second image based on the depth information of a set of first common feature points and the position information of the set of first common feature points in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ding image for each second image.

[0093] S150, based on the depth information of the first common feature point, the position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image, the first three-dimensional model is supplemented and constructed to obtain the second three-dimensional model.

[0094] Based on the depth information of the first common feature point, the position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image, a 3D model in the camera coordinate system of each second image can be constructed. Then, the 3D model in the camera coordinate system of each second image is transformed into a 3D model in the world coordinate system to supplement the first 3D model and obtain the second 3D model.

[0095] Specifically, based on the depth information of each first common feature point, the position information of each first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the second image, and the camera pose information of the second image, the three-dimensional position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the second image can be obtained. Then, the three-dimensional position information of the first common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the second image is converted into the three-dimensional position information in the world coordinate system.

[0096] The second 3D model information includes the coordinate information of multiple 3D points and the camera pose information of each image. Compared with the first 3D model, the second 3D model includes more 3D points and more camera pose information for each image.

[0097] The method for constructing a 3D model provided in this embodiment of the invention no longer requires the simultaneous acquisition of image data and 3D point cloud data. The accurate construction of the 3D model is achieved through the registration of the acquired image data and 3D point cloud data.

[0098] When there are multiple second images, since different second images may also include imaging points of the same scene, these imaging points can participate in the construction of the 3D model to improve the completeness of the 3D model construction. In one embodiment of the present invention, the 3D model construction method further includes: for every two second images, obtaining second common feature points; determining the depth information of the second common feature points based on the position information of the second common feature points in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image; and supplementing the second 3D model with the depth information of the second common feature points, the position information of the second common feature points in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image to obtain a third 3D model.

[0099] The number of second common feature points in each group can be multiple.

[0100] The depth information of the second common feature point can be determined using the Direct Linear Transform (DLT) triangulation method.

[0101] Based on each pair of second images, according to the depth information of the second common feature points, the position information of the second common feature points in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image, a 3D model in the camera coordinate system of each of the two second images can be constructed. Then, the 3D models in the camera coordinate system of each of the two second images are transformed into 3D models in the world coordinate system to supplement the second 3D model and obtain a third 3D model.

[0102] Specifically, based on the depth information of each second common feature point, the position information of each second common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ding second image, and the camera pose information of the corresponding second image, the three-dimensional position information of the second common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the second image can be obtained. Then, the three-dimensional position information of the second common feature point in the camera coordinate system of the second image is converted into the three-dimensional position information in the world coordinate system.

[0103] In one embodiment of the present invention, after supplementing the first three-dimensional model based on each second image, the supplemented three-dimensional model is optimized to improve the construction accuracy of the three-dimensional model. This optimization operation specifically includes steps S211 to S213.

[0104] S211, acquire the camera pose information of the image participating in the construction of the 3D model, the coordinate information of the 3D points of the constructed 3D model, the position information of the common feature points participating in the construction of the 3D model in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ding image, and the 3D point cloud information of the radar points corresponding to the 3D points.

[0105] The 3D point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the 3D point can be determined according to the following steps.

[0106] To distinguish whether the second image corresponding to a 3D point includes the last image used in the 3D model construction, this embodiment uses "first" and "second" to differentiate them. Both the first and second 3D points represent a class of 3D points. The second image corresponding to the first 3D point includes the last image used in the 3D model construction. The second image corresponding to the second 3D point does not include the last image used in the 3D model construction. Both the first and second 3D points represent a class of 3D points.

[0107] S211a, obtain all the second images corresponding to each 3D point.

[0108] The second image corresponding to a 3D point refers to the 3D point being determined based on the second image according to the above-mentioned method for supplementing and constructing the first 3D model.

[0109] The second image corresponding to this 3D point can be one or more.

[0110] S211b, when all the second images corresponding to the first three-dimensional point include the last image involved in the construction of the three-dimensional model, extract the target image from all the second images corresponding to the first three-dimensional point; wherein the number of common feature points between the target image and the last image involved in the construction of the three-dimensional model exceeds a first preset threshold.

[0111] If there are multiple target images, one can be selected at will.

[0112] The last image involved in the construction of the 3D model in this step refers to the current image involved in the construction of the 3D model.

[0113] S211c: Based on the camera pose information of the target image, the 3D point cloud map is projected onto the camera imaging plane corresponding to the target image to obtain the projection result.

[0114] The projection method can be referred to above. Figure 2The projection method shown will not be elaborated further here.

[0115] S211d, where the projection point of a radar point in the projection result of a three-dimensional point cloud map coincides with a common feature point, and the common feature point is a pixel corresponding to the first three-dimensional point, the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point is used as the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the first three-dimensional point.

[0116] The pixel corresponding to the first 3D point refers to the pixel that determines the first 3D point. This 3D point is determined based on this pixel using the aforementioned method for supplementing and constructing the first 3D model.

[0117] S211e, when multiple radar points in the projection result of the three-dimensional point cloud map coincide with the same common feature point, and the common feature point is the pixel point corresponding to the first three-dimensional point, multiple included angle values ​​are obtained based on the line connecting each radar point to the same common feature point and the normal vector of the local surface corresponding to each radar point; the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the smallest included angle value is selected, and the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the smallest included angle value is used as the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the first three-dimensional point.

[0118] Based on a single radar point, multiple neighboring radar points are acquired. The distance between each neighboring radar point and the given radar point must not exceed a preset distance threshold. The number of neighboring radar points can be two or three, without specific limitation. Then, a local surface is fitted using the given radar point and its multiple neighboring radar points. When the curvature of the local surface is 0, the local surface is a plane.

[0119] An angle value is the angle between a line and the normal vector of the local surface corresponding to a radar point. A line is a line connecting a radar point to a point sharing the same common feature.

[0120] It should be noted that not every common feature point can be used to identify a corresponding radar point.

[0121] S211f, if the second image corresponding to the second three-dimensional point does not include the last image involved in the construction of the three-dimensional model, determine the radar point closest to the second three-dimensional point, and use the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point closest to the second three-dimensional point as the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the second three-dimensional point.

[0122] S212, the camera pose information of the images involved in model construction, the coordinate information of the 3D points of the supplemented 3D model, the position information of the common feature points involved in the 3D model construction in the camera coordinate system of the corresponding images, and the 3D point information of the radar points corresponding to the 3D points are input into the factor graph to obtain the optimized camera pose information of each image and the optimized coordinate information of the 3D points.

[0123] In one specific embodiment, S212 includes S212a to S212d.

[0124] S212a, the camera pose information of the images participating in model construction is divided into a first group of camera pose information and a second group of camera pose information; wherein, the number of common feature points between the image corresponding to the first group of camera pose information and the last image participating in 3D model construction exceeds a second preset threshold, and the number of common feature points between the image corresponding to the second group of camera pose information and the last image participating in model construction does not exceed the second preset threshold.

[0125] The last image involved in the construction of the 3D model refers to the current image involved in the construction of the 3D model.

[0126] S212b, the coordinate information of the three-dimensional points of the supplemented three-dimensional model is divided into the coordinate information of the first group of three-dimensional points and the coordinate information of the second group of three-dimensional points; wherein, the number of images corresponding to the first group of three-dimensional points exceeds the third preset threshold, and the number of images corresponding to the second group of three-dimensional points does not exceed the third preset threshold.

[0127] The image corresponding to a 3D point refers to the image upon which the 3D point is determined.

[0128] S212c determines the distance between each 3D point and its corresponding radar point.

[0129] Specifically, a distance value is determined based on the position coordinates of the three-dimensional point and the corresponding three-dimensional coordinates of the radar point.

[0130] S212d uses the first set of camera pose information, the first set of 3D point coordinate information, and the position information of common feature points participating in the 3D model construction in the corresponding image's camera coordinate system as fixed factors, the second set of camera pose information and the second set of 3D point coordinate information as variable factors, and the distance values ​​between each 3D point and the corresponding radar point as the edges of the factors. These are input into the factor graph to obtain the optimized camera pose information and optimized 3D point coordinate information for each image.

[0131] S213. Based on the optimized camera pose information of each image and the optimized coordinate information of the 3D points, the optimized 3D model is obtained.

[0132] In one embodiment of the present invention, after supplementing the first three-dimensional model based on a preset number of second images, the supplemented three-dimensional model is optimized to improve the construction accuracy of the three-dimensional model. This optimization operation specifically includes steps S214 to S216.

[0133] S214, when the first three-dimensional model is supplemented by a preset number of second images, the camera pose information of the images located within a specific spatial range, the coordinate information of the three-dimensional points determined based on the images located within the specific spatial range, and the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ar points corresponding to the three-dimensional points are obtained; wherein, the specific spatial range is obtained with the center of the camera corresponding to the last image participating in the construction of the three-dimensional model as the center of the sphere and a preset radius as the radius.

[0134] See Figure 3 Using the camera center O2 corresponding to the last image involved in the 3D model construction as the center of the sphere and a preset radius as the radius, a sphere is obtained.

[0135] S215, the camera pose information of the image within a specific spatial range, the coordinate information of the three-dimensional points determined based on the image within the specific spatial range, and the three-dimensional point cloud information of the radar points corresponding to the three-dimensional points are input into the factor map to obtain the optimized camera pose information of the image within the specific spatial range and the optimized coordinate information of the three-dimensional points within the specific spatial range.

[0136] Based on each image located within a specific spatial range, the corresponding three-dimensional points can be determined by following the above-described method for constructing the first three-dimensional model.

[0137] The 3D point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the 3D point can be determined in the following way: determine the radar point that is closest to the 3D point, and use the 3D point cloud information of the radar point that is closest to the 3D point as the 3D point cloud information of the radar point corresponding to the 3D point.

[0138] S216. Based on the camera pose information of the image within the optimized specific spatial range and the coordinate information of the three-dimensional points within the optimized specific spatial range, the optimized three-dimensional model is obtained.
